Braille art case, from sustainable material, available

Villa-Cavrois-small.jpgBuilt in 1932 by architect Robert Mallet-Stevens and restored in 2015, the Villa Cavrois, open to the public, is part of the French Monuments Nationaux. A braille art box containing tactile embossed sheets made from responsible material has been published, edited by the Editions du Patrimoine, with the support of the Fondation Bettencourt Schueller and the Amis de la Villa.

Glamorous luxury hotel on the French Riviera Green Globe-certified

Hotel-Martinez-Green-Globe-small.jpg

Restored in 2018, the Hotel Martinez has been again awarded the Green Globe certification, previously obtained in 2010 and the Gold Member status of the label, which is awarded to members that are certified for 5 consecutive years.
